*Job Title: Business Analyst (Functional)*
*Location: HOUSTON TX*
*Duration: 5+ Months*
*C2C Rate : $45/hr*

*Job Description: *
We are looking for strong Endur Business Analysts to be part of our
Blueprint R2 team.
Our team needs experienced, hands-on BAs with basic technical Endur
competency as well.
We are not looking for managers, architects nor thought-leaders – we need
people who can ‘get their hands dirty’ design the solution, as well as
learn existing functionalities.
We expect our BAs to have the solid experience and flexibility to fit in
with R2s different functional teams (Marine, Truck/Rail, Pipeline,
Derivatives, Connected Application Portfolio (CAP) and Data). Business
Analysts are responsible for the identification and definition of the
business needs of their clients and stakeholders, and to help determine
solution(s) to meet their business needs or resolve their business
problem(s).

Responsibilities:
Research, understand, document, and articulate business requirements, and
control requirements, for R2’s functional teams (Marine, Truck/Rail,
Pipeline and Derivatives)
Analyze business processes and translate business requirements into
functional requirements and design; wherever possible, identify alternative
solutions, assess feasibility and recommend new approaches
Document and communicate functional designs with other work stream BAs and
developers, ensuring knowledge transfer is effectively completed
Review detailed technical design
Prepare test cases, recommend data that reflects realistic operational
business conditions, and participate in testing at both unit and
integration levels
Provide advice and guidance to database designers using the Endur data
structures and associated components
Work with solution authority architects, knowledge SMEs and business users
to get their agreement on design, have them participate in unit and
acceptance testing, and get their agreement to deploy

Deliver to plan Requirements:
Minimum of four (4) years of recent experience as a Business Analyst using
the Openlink Endur application
Proven track record of strong delivery in previous implementation
assignments
Commensurate experience in commodity trading to include deal capture, risk
management, scheduling and / or settlements and accounting. .
Demonstrates high standards of professional behavior in dealings with
business and IT colleagues. Has in depth knowledge of at least one specific
IT area or business and a broad understanding across a wide field along
with a record of applying such knowledge successfully in a variety of
situations
Possesses strong inter-personal skills and values teamwork, especially in
handling contacts of all types and at all levels
Takes a systematic and analytical approach to problem solving and pays
close attention to detail
